Starbucks sees decline in sales as customers opt for cheaper coffee options

July 30, 2024No Comments3 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Telegram Email WhatsApp Copy Link

Consumers are starting to reach their breaking point with the high prices of $6 iced coffees and lemonades at Starbucks, as demonstrated by a 3% drop in global sales at stores open for at least a year. In the North American market, sales fell by 2% and transactions at North American stores open for at least a year dropped by 6% in the quarter. These declines come despite the increase in prices, marking Starbucks’ second-straight quarter of sales declines.

The struggles faced by Starbucks reflect a larger trend of consumer fatigue with high prices at food chains, restaurants, and stores. McDonald’s also reported a 1% drop in sales at stores open for at least a year last quarter, indicating that consumers are showing their limits at popular chains. Despite these challenges, shares of Starbucks rose more than 2% in afterhours trading, suggesting some optimism from investors in the company’s ability to rebound from its recent sales declines.
